Sad But Kinda Funny started as an unfiltered, slightly chaotic, and oddly comforting podcast where two longtime friends, Brittney and Jennifer, reunited after years apart to talk about life, depression, leaving corporate, and the messy moments in between. It was real talk with zero pretension, equal parts vulnerable and hilarious, where even the bad days could still land a good punchline.


As life tends to do, things evolve. Jennifer has stepped back from the podcast to focus on a few things currently filling her plate, and Brittney will continue the journey forward. The heart of the podcast isn’t changing, it’s still honest, real, and sometimes a little sarcastic, but the format will shift.


Moving forward, Sad But Kinda Funny will feature rotating co-hosts for a few episodes at a time, along with guests from all walks of life and different stages of their journeys. Some conversations will be light, some a little deeper, and most will land somewhere in the middle because life rarely stays in just one lane.

From awkward adulthood moments to the heavier stuff we don’t usually say out loud, Sad But Kinda Funny is still a space where honesty wins, laughter sneaks in when you least expect it, and even the sad parts might come with a sarcastic snort.
